Latest Patents

Among his latest patents, Rosen has developed sulfatases and polypeptides associated with them, along with nucleic acid compositions that encode these enzymes. These inventions pave the way for applications in diagnosing and selecting therapeutic agents. In particular, methods to inhibit tumor-induced angiogenesis have also been addressed through his work, focusing on using inhibitors of these sulfatases to treat related disease conditions. Additionally, he has introduced glycosyl sulfotransferases GST-4α, GST-4β, and GST-6, which again include significant polypeptides and nucleic acid compositions. These inventions hold promise for various applications, particularly in diagnosing and treating selectin mediated binding events, thereby offering solutions for related health issues.
